jQuery param() 方法

17 Mar 2025 | 阅读 2 分钟

jQuery 的 param() 方法允许我们创建一个对象的序列化表示或数组。在进行 AJAX 请求时,我们可以将这些序列化值用在 URL 字符串中。

该方法有两个参数,objtrad,其中第一个是必需的,第二个参数是可选的。

语法

该方法的参数值定义如下。

参数值

obj: 这是必需的参数。它可以是需要序列化的数组或对象。

trad: 这个可选参数是一个布尔值,用于指定是否使用传统的 param 序列化样式。

让我们来看一些示例,以了解如何使用 param() 方法。

示例 1

在此示例中,我们将 param() 方法用于创建对象的序列化表示。这里有一个名为 student 的对象,包含一些学生详细信息。我们在 student 对象上实现 param() 方法以创建其序列化表示。

立即测试

输出

执行上述代码后,输出将是 -

jQuery param() method

单击给定按钮后,输出将是 -

jQuery param() method

示例 2

在此示例中,存在一些复杂对象。我们将 param() 方法应用于这些复杂对象以查看结果。这里我们使用 decodeURIComponent 来显示解码后的对象。

这里有两个对象 obj1obj2。我们将 param() 方法应用于这些对象并以解码格式显示结果。

执行上述代码后,输出将是 -

jQuery param() method

单击给定按钮后,输出将是 -

jQuery param() method